15-year-old boy shot in Rogers Park on Halloween night

Last updated: November 1, 2024 5:25 am
Share
15-year-old boy shot in Rogers Park on Halloween night
SHARE

A shooting incident occurred in Rogers Park on Halloween night, where a 15-year-old boy became the eighth victim of gun violence in the neighborhood during the month of October. The Chicago Police Department revealed that surveillance footage captured the moment when the gunman fired shots from the southwest corner of Damen and Rogers at around 7:50 p.m. The teenager sustained two gunshot wounds to his ankle but was reported to be in good condition following the attack.

Law enforcement officers detained three individuals for questioning in the vicinity, but they were later released. The suspected shooter, as seen in the video, was described as a Black male wearing a black hoodie, black pants, and white shoes. This incident adds to the tally of 27 shootings in Rogers Park so far this year, compared to 29 during the same period last year and 26 in 2022.

It is worth noting that the seven previous shooting victims in October were targeted in separate incidents. These incidents took place on October 6 in the 1500 block of West Morse, October 11 in the 1600 block of West Juneway Terrace, October 20 in the 1300 block of West Morse, and October 28 in the 1200 block of West Loyola. Additionally, three individuals were shot during a single occurrence in the 1600 block of West Howard on October 23.
